Life Sciences introduce students to living organisms and their interactions. Why do plants need sunlight? Because chlorophyll in plant cells captures light energy, transforming it into chemical energy through photosynthesis—a process vital to nearly all life on Earth. Students learn how plants convert carbon dioxide and water into glucose and oxygen, sustaining ecosystems worldwide. Understanding this cycle helps explain why preserving green spaces supports planetary health. Earth Science dives into the planet’s layers, motion, and changes over time. Why do earthquakes happen? They occur when tectonic plates shift beneath Earth’s crust, releasing stored energy as seismic waves that shake the surface. Students also explore the water cycle: evaporation from oceans feeds clouds that return rain to land, sustaining forests and rivers across continents. Physical Science focuses on matter and energy transformations—key ideas in 7th grade classrooms. What makes ice melt into water? When heat energy breaks hydrogen bonds between water molecules, their motion increases until they transition from solid to liquid state—a phase change driven by thermal input. Understanding these shifts helps explain everyday phenomena like melting snow or boiling water during cooking experiments studied in labs. Weather patterns reveal dynamic atmospheric processes driven by solar heat. Why does rain fall? Warm air rises near the equator; as it ascends, it cools and condenses into clouds—eventually releasing moisture as rain when saturation occurs. Earth’s systems are interconnected—a core theme in this guide. How do volcanic eruptions affect climate? Eruptions inject ash and sulfur dioxide high into the stratosphere—cooling Earth’s surface temporarily by reflecting sunlight back into space—and release gases altering atmospheric composition over time.
